GKE: защитить кластер от случайного удаления - PullRequest
0 голосов
/ 20 сентября 2019

Есть ли в Google Kubernetes Engine способ предотвратить случайное удаление кластера.

Я знаю, что это можно установить на уровне Compute Engine, как описано в соответствующих документах .

Кажется, я не могу найти что-то на уровне кластера.

1 Ответ

1 голос
/ 20 сентября 2019

Точно так же, как вам нужно, чтобы избежать удаления кластера и всех ресурсов, связанных с ним, есть все еще работы на будущее, некоторые в пользу некоторых против, как вы можете прочитать здесь [1] речь идет о том, что это длилось довольно долго (почти 4 года), и некоторые из этих флагов установлены в управляемых ресурсах в GKE, так что можно выполнять только обновления (или полный кластер до свидания), но некоторые из флаговможет не работать в других ресурсах (например, «защищенных»), поэтому обработка этого все еще оплачивается пользователю, который должен быть осторожен при применении YAML, которые могут повлиять на конфигурацию, циклы развертывания и ресурсы в его / ее кластерах.В GKE он фактически запрашивает дважды (даже если это выглядит как один раз) при сбросе кластера, см. [2], но еще раз, полагается на клиента.

Я надеюсь, что эта информация может быть полезна для вас.


[1] https://github.com/kubernetes/kubernetes/issues/10179

[2] https://cloud.google.com/kubernetes-engine/docs/how-to/deleting-a-cluster

...